On September 26th and 27th the Tanabe City Kumano Tourism Bureau and the Wakayama Prefecture Government visited the city of Santiago de Compostela in Spain.
The Tanabe City Kumano Tourism Bureau and Turismo de Santiago de Compostela have been working together during joint promotion since 2008. The Kumano Kodo and the Way of St. James are the only two pilgrimage routes registered as UNESCO World Heritage sites.
During this trip we met with officials from the Galicia Government and the City of Santiago de Compostela.
We are working towards creating joint posters and panels highlighting these two sacred routes, which was the focus of this trip.
